Inaugurele rede dr. Damian Trilling (Vrije Universiteit)

July 3, 2025/in RMeS News /by Chantal

Datum: vrijdag 12 september 2025 om 15.45 uur precies
Locatie: Vrije Universiteit – Aula, De Boelelaan 1105, Amsterdam

Op vrijdag 12 juni vindt de openbare zitting van het College van Decanen plaats, waarin dr. D.C. Trilling benoemd tot hoogleraar Journalistiek wetenschap, dit ambt hoopt te aanvaarden met het uitspreken van de rede:

Dit vind je vast ook leuk: Waarom een veranderende journalistiek een creatievere journalistiekwetenschap nodig heeft

(“You might like this one as well: Why changing journalism needs more creative journalism studies”)

During the inaugural lecture, Damian Trilling will sketch the challenges and opportunities that are inherent to the rapid changes journalism is undergoing: The increasing role of algorithmic systems like recommender systems, the use of so-called artificial intelligence, the rise of platforms, but also changing news consumption patterns in general. He will argue how this calls for more creative journalism studies: developing innovative methods that are appropriate to study these new phenomena, bridge gaps between qualitatiative, traditional quantitative, and computational methods – but also focusing on building and creating. Building on a wide range of examples of such creative approaches to journalism studies, he will outline a theoretical and methodolical research agenda for the next years – one that, by design, needs to remain open for creative changes along the way.
